The Enchanting World of Indian Musical Instruments

 

The rich and diverse culture of India is mirrored in its captivating music, which is a fusion of tradition and innovation. At the heart of this musical landscape are the Indian musical instruments, each with its unique sound, history, and cultural significance. In this blog, we'll embark on a melodic journey through the world of Indian musical instruments, exploring the role they play in the tapestry of Indian music.

Sitar: The Jewel of Indian Classical Music

The sitar is one of India's most iconic instruments, known for its graceful form and captivating sound. Its distinctive long neck, resonating gourd, and intricate strings make it a beloved instrument in Indian classical music. The sitar's melodic and drone strings produce the enchanting notes that have been a part of classical Indian compositions for centuries.

Tabla: The Rhythmic Heartbeat

If the sitar is the melody, the tabla is the heartbeat of Indian music. This pair of hand-played drums consists of the smaller, treble drum (tabla) and the larger, bass drum (bayan). Tabla players use their fingers to create intricate rhythms and patterns, providing the rhythm and structure for classical and contemporary compositions alike.

Flute: The Soulful Serenade

The flute, with its sweet and soulful notes, has a timeless presence in Indian music. Artists like Pandit Hariprasad Chaurasia have made the bamboo flute a global sensation. It's often used to evoke feelings of tranquility and spirituality, making it a beloved choice for devotional music and classical compositions.

Veena: The Ancient Virtuoso

The veena is an ancient stringed instrument with a history dating back thousands of years. It's considered the precursor to many modern stringed instruments, including the sitar. The veena's intricate frets and resonating gourd create a unique sound, making it a cherished component of classical music and spiritual hymns.

Dhol: The Rhythmic Celebration

For lively and vibrant music, the dhol takes center stage. This double-headed drum, often played with sticks, adds an exhilarating rhythm to Bhangra dance, folk music, and festive celebrations. Its powerful beats and energetic sound are integral to cultural festivities.

Harmonium: The Devotional Companion

The harmonium is a keyboard instrument that plays a crucial role in devotional and classical music. Its ability to produce sustained harmonious notes makes it an excellent accompaniment to vocalists and instrumentalists. It's a common fixture in Bhajans, Kirtans, and Ghazals.

Harmonium: The Soulful Resonance of Indian Music

 In the vibrant landscape of Indian music, the harmonium stands as a symbol of soulful resonance and melodic elegance. This small, portable keyboard instrument has woven its harmonious tapestry into the fabric of Indian musical traditions, offering both versatility and emotional depth to countless compositions. Join us on a musical journey as we explore the captivating world of the harmonium.


The Harmonium's Origins

The harmonium, despite its strong association with Indian music, has European origins. Introduced to India during the British colonial period, it quickly found a place in the hearts of Indian musicians. With its reed-based sound production, it offered a unique blend of melody and harmony, making it an ideal accompaniment for classical and devotional music.

A Portable Treasure

One of the harmonium's most endearing qualities is its portability. Musicians can carry it with ease to concerts, temples, and gatherings, allowing them to infuse their music with its melodic charm wherever they go. This portability has made it an indispensable instrument in various musical traditions across India.


Devotional Music and the Harmonium

The harmonium holds a special place in the realm of devotional music. It often accompanies bhajans (devotional songs) and kirtans (spiritual chants) in temples and gatherings. Its gentle, resonant tones add a layer of spirituality to the singing, enhancing the overall devotional experience.


Harmonium in Ghazals and Classical Music

Beyond its role in devotional music, the harmonium is a versatile companion in Indian classical music as well. It provides the melodic framework for vocalists and instrumentalists alike. Its ability to sustain notes and produce nuanced dynamics adds depth and emotion to classical compositions.


Fusion and Contemporary Music

The harmonium's adaptability extends to fusion and contemporary music genres. In recent years, it has found a place in experimental and fusion projects, where musicians blend traditional Indian melodies with modern sounds. This fusion showcases the harmonium's ability to bridge the gap between tradition and innovation.

The Resounding Rhythms of Dhol: A Heartbeat of Celebration

 

In the vibrant tapestry of cultural diversity that is India, the dhol stands tall as an emblem of joy, energy, and celebration. This traditional double-headed drum holds a special place in the hearts of millions, as its resounding beats have been an integral part of festivities, rituals, and cultural performances for centuries. Let us delve into the rhythmic world of the dhol and uncover the infectious spirit it brings to every occasion.

The history of the dhol can be traced back to ancient times, where it found its roots in the Indian subcontinent. Its evolution has been shaped by regional influences, resulting in various forms and sizes across different states. Traditionally, the dhol is crafted from wood and animal skin, with the two heads - the larger bass head known as "dagga" and the smaller treble head known as "thili" - producing distinctive sounds that merge harmoniously to create captivating beats.

In every corner of India, the dhol is an inseparable companion of celebrations. Be it weddings, festivals, or religious gatherings, the rhythmic beats of the dhol set the pace for exuberant dances and revelries. The lively and infectious energy it exudes brings people together, transcending age, caste, and creed, as everyone joins in the revelry, tapping their feet to its vibrant rhythm.

In the realm of folk music and dance, the dhol is an essential component. Folk artists and dancers perform to its beats, infusing the air with a sense of cultural richness. The Bhangra dance of Punjab and the Garba dance of Gujarat are prime examples of how the dhol weaves its magic, elevating the enthusiasm and fervor of the participants to new heights.

Apart from its traditional significance, the dhol has also found its way into contemporary music and popular culture. In modern Bollywood songs, the dhol's powerful beats add a punch of excitement, making the music irresistible to dance to. International musicians, too, have embraced the dhol's raw energy, incorporating it into fusion and world music, giving it a global platform and making it resonate with audiences worldwide.

Learning to play the dhol is an art that requires skill and dedication. Traditionally, dhol players acquire their expertise through the guru-shishya parampara (teacher-disciple tradition), imbibing not only the technical aspects of playing but also the essence of the instrument's cultural significance. Today, music schools and online tutorials provide aspiring dhol players with opportunities to hone their craft and carry forward the legacy of this iconic drum.
